Goldbach's conjecture says every even integer greater than 2 is the sum of two primes. For 38310, here are decompositions:
- 7 + 38303 = 38310
- 11 + 38299 = 38310
- 23 + 38287 = 38310
- 29 + 38281 = 38310
- 37 + 38273 = 38310
- 71 + 38239 = 38310
- 73 + 38237 = 38310
- 79 + 38231 = 38310
Showing the first eight; more decompositions exist.
